关于javawebapps的信息
华为云服务器特价优惠火热进行中! 2核2G2兆仅需 38 元;4核4G3兆仅需 79 元。购买时间越长越优惠!更多配置及优惠价格请咨询客服。
合作流程: |
本篇文章给大家谈谈javawebapps,以及对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
微信号:cloud7591如需了解更多,欢迎添加客服微信咨询。
复制微信号
本文目录一览:
- 1、Java类别载入器
- 2、如何在tomcat的webapps目录下创建java数据源
- 3、为什么java运行需要tomcat?
- 4、在tomcat上发布javaweb应用默认在什么目录
- 5、...有关问题,项目名称是不是以Tomcat目录中的webapps为准的?
- 6、在java程序中获得Tomcat下的webapps绝对路径的程序怎么写?
Java类别载入器
引导类加载器用来加载Java的核心库,引导类加载器用原生代码来实现。扩展类加载器用来加载Java的扩展库,该类加载器在此目录里面查找并加载Java类。系统类加载器根据Java应用的类路径来加载Java类。
类加载器有四种,分别是 bootstrapClassLoader (主要加载java核心api) , ExtClassLoaders是扩展类的类加载器,AppClassLoader 程序类加载器,还有一个是用户继承ClassLoader重写的类加载器。
java中的类要加载到jvm中才能使用,那么把java类加载到jvm中的工具,就是类加载器。

如何在tomcat的webapps目录下创建java数据源
将test目录拷贝到$CATALINA_HOME\webapps下,然后启动服务器就可以了。这种方式比较简单,但是web应用程序必须在webapps目录下。
最原始的做法是将java程序编译成.class文件,复制到tomcat中你的项目里的相应位置。
。安装tomcat 2。将web项目打成war包 3。
第一步、这个图的左边那个按钮就是部署按钮,中间的那个是启动服务器的、点下下三角可以选择。第二步、我是已经部署上去的,你没有的话,点Add,再选择你装好的tomcat。deploy就是部署的意思。。
部署javaweb项目。有两种方法,一种是将项目打包成war文件,放到Tomcat的webapps目录下,启动Tomcat后会自动解压和部署;另一种是在IDEA中配置Tomcat服务器,将项目添加到Deployment中,然后运行Tomcat。启动Tomcat服务器。
直接放到Webapps目录下 Tomcat的Webapps目录是Tomcat默认的应用目录,当服务器启动时,会加载所有这个目录 下的应用。
为什么java运行需要tomcat?
都必须运行在一个JVM之上。换句话说,Tomcat并不是java开发者必须的,jvm才是必须的,这就是我们常说的要装一个JDK才能运行Java的原因。因此,java运行必须的不是Tomcat,JVM/JDK/JRE才是。
可靠性高:Tomcat具有很高的可靠性,可以保证应用程序的持续运行。 丰富的功能:Tomcat支持多种协议、安全身份验证、容器集成、负载平衡、会话管理等功能。
tomcat是服务器,是一种比较简单的中间件,用来把java web开发部署到tomcat中,此时tomcat是作为服务器的。java的可移植性设计让java依赖class文件运行的。jdk就是java运行的环境,使用它能编译.java文件,运行java程序。
tomcat,它是使用Java进行Web开发的应用服务器(Application Server)软件。服务器与浏览器的沟通是通过特定的格式进行的,这个格式被称作HTTP协议,HTTP协议有很多内容需要处理,如果所有这些都由开发者来做,未免负担过重。
tomcat是服务器,web项目必须部署到服务器中才能访问。java有socket 不是所有java程序都需要放到tomcat才能运行。
由于有了Sun 的参与和支持,最新的Servlet 和JSP 规范总是能在Tomcat 中得到体现,Tomcat 5 支持最新的Servlet 4 和JSP 0 规范。
在tomcat上发布javaweb应用默认在什么目录
1、那就必须要修改TOMCAT的默认运行JSP的目录了。
2、tomcat的webapps是应用程序发布的目录,当把应用程序打包发布到这个目录下,启动tomcat会自动解压出来,然后在服务器运行就可以了。
3、Tomcat的Webapps目录是Tomcat默认的应用目录。Tomcat的Webapps目录是Tomcat默认的应用目录,当服务器启动时,会加载所有这个目录下的应用,Web应用程序才能访问。
4、一般都是在tomcat主目录的webapps的目录下面,但你也可以在server.xml里面设置你的工程目录,如果你在设置时设为根则在webapps的目录下面的ROOT那里。
...有关问题,项目名称是不是以Tomcat目录中的webapps为准的?
不一定。webapps是默认项目文件的路径,将项目文件放在该路径下,tomcat会自动调用它,但我们也可以自己指定路径。
直接将web项目文件件拷贝到webapps 目录中 Tomcat的Webapps目录是Tomcat默认的应用目录,当服务器启动时,会加载所有这个目录下的应用。
webapps下可以直接放入,这样tomcat会去寻找。在Server.xml中加入context,进行加载项目,这样的项目可以不放入webapps下。在conf/catalina下也可以生成一些项目名.xml,这也是需要注意的。
你确定部署好了吗? 首先你要确定代码的执行时候的正确性 , 还有就是部署后启动tomcat是否异常 。之后要看好自己的访问路径的正确与否。
把整个项目复制到tomcat里也是可以的,但是其实不需要那么多,只需要你项目的web或者WEB-INF目录就够了,因为tomcat也只认识已经编译好的.class文件。
在java程序中获得Tomcat下的webapps绝对路径的程序怎么写?
1、//也许有你想要的,前提是在项目布署运行起来后,在servlet中或controller中运行以下代码即可。
2、基本概念的理解绝对路径:绝对路径就是你的主页上的文件或目录在硬盘上真正的路径,(URL和物理路径)例 如:C:xyz est.txt 代表了test.txt文件的绝对路径。http://也代表了一个URL绝对路径。
3、可以通过“ 类名.class.getResource().getPath()”方法实现。
4、第一步:需要先创建一个server,可以通过windows中的show view,之后找到server,第二步:在server窗口中右击,选择”new-server“,之后创建好tomcat server。
5、Tomcat默认可以自动加载webapps下的Web应用程序。如果想避开MyEclipse的deploy步骤,直接让Tomcat添加workspace下的应用程序为Web应用程序上下文,则可以在Tomcat的conf下的server.xml文件中进行配置。
javawebapps的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于、javawebapps的信息别忘了在本站进行查找喔。
